WHAT IS SUICIDE?
• Suicide, also known as completed suicide, is the "act of taking one's own life".
• Attempted suicide or non-fatal suicidal behavior is self-injury with the desire to end one's life that does not result in death.
• Common methods include hanging, pesticide poisoning and firearms.
• Around 800,000 to a million people die by suicide every year, making it the 10th leading cause of death worldwide.
• Rates are higher in men than in women, with males three to four times more likely to kill themselves than females.

HOW CHECKUP APPS
WORKS???
• This app works by scanning the Facebook or Twitter timeline of anyone who has signed up at checkupapp.org.
• The software scans tweet(a posting on Twitter) every two minutes for language that indicates self-harming or suicidal behaviour or thoughts.
• CheckUp software looks for key phrases
“For example, if it has the words ‘cut myself’ and it doesn’t have the words ‘accidentally’ or ‘shaving,’ then it would be flagged.”
• If the software finds a tweet that meets the first criteria, then it conducts “sentiment analysis” on the user’s profile. It scans some of the user’s other tweets and determines whether there is a trend of negative tweets.
• If a tweet is “flagged,” an email is sent to anyone who is following that person and using the app, warning them that their friend may be having suicidal thoughts.
“ This person just tweeted/posted this. They might be having a rough time. Maybe you should check up on this person.”
And then it will have a link to their Facebook or Twitter account.

HOW TO DETECT SUICIDE VIA SMS
• Any talk about suicide, dying, or self-harm, such as "I wish I hadn't been born," "If I see you again..." and "I'd be better off dead.“
• Feelings of helplessness, hopelessness, and being trapped ("There's no way out"). Belief that things will never get better or change.
• Unusual or unexpected message to family and friends. Saying goodbye to people as if they won't be seen again.
• Feelings of worthlessness, guilt, shame, and self-hatred. Feeling like a burden ("Everyone would be better off without me").

PREVENTION APPLICATION VIA SMS
• type a message into the sms facility on the cell phone then sends the message to 31393.
• This message comes directly to the SADAG call centre computers within seconds. At the call center, a skilled counselor replies to this message by typing a response into the computer, this reply appears on the teen's screen in the format of an sms.
• This service is instant and a teen will never get a busy signal when he or she is in crisis.
